What Exactly is an AI Agent, Anyway?

Alright, let’s break it down without all the jargon. An AI agent is basically a smart program that can perceive its environment, make decisions, and take actions to achieve specific goals. It’s not just a chatbot chatting away; it’s more like a virtual assistant with superpowers. For instance, imagine an agent that monitors stock prices and alerts you when it’s time to buy or sell – that’s real-world utility right there.

In the context of Agent Factory, these agents are built to be modular and customizable. You don’t need a PhD in computer science; the platform provides drag-and-drop interfaces and pre-built components.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

Ah, the rookie mistakes. One biggie is scope creep – trying to make your agent do too much too soon. Start simple, like automating one task, then expand. I learned this the hard way when my agent overloaded and started sending gibberish emails.

Another trap: Ignoring ethics. Ensure your agent respects privacy and avoids bias. Agent Factory has guidelines, but it’s on you to implement them. Also, test thoroughly – real-world outcomes mean real consequences if it glitches.

Scaling Up: From First Agent to AI Empire

Once you’ve nailed the basics, think bigger. Chain multiple agents together for complex workflows. For example, one agent gathers data, another analyzes it, and a third generates reports. Agent Factory supports this seamlessly.

Integrate with advanced APIs for more power. Connect to services like OpenAI for enhanced intelligence or CRM tools for business insights. I’ve seen teams build entire automation suites that rival enterprise software, all on a budget.
